The Hartford to use AI technology for faster claims processing

Property-casualty insurer The Hartford is adopting artificial intelligence technology from London-based insurtech firm Tractable for a system that analyzes damage to vehicles it insures.

Tractable’s technology uses photos and AI to assess damage at rates faster than humans can, which allows for a faster claims process, according to Tractable.

“Computer vision is accelerating accident recovery; the technology is here, it’s on the ground and it’s making a difference,”  Alex Dalyac, co-founder and CEO, Tractable, said.

Financial details of the deal were not disclosed.

Tractable was co-founded in 2015 and has since raised $55M in venture funding.
